Lead Software Engineer - C# .NET Desktop App

January 23

Apply Now
Logo of Mimica

Mimica

Machine Learning • Artificial Intelligence • RPA • Process Mapping • Process Discovery

11 - 50

Description

•We prioritize customer needs first •We work in small, project-based teams •We have flexibility in terms of the problems we work on •We own the full lifecycle of our projects •We avoid silos and encourage taking up tasks in new areas •We balance quality and velocity •We have a shared responsibility for our production code •We each set our own routine to maximize our productivity

Requirements

•Background in developing and deploying Windows applications (WinForms/WPF) •Proficiency with the Microsoft .NET stack (C#, .NET Framework, .NET Core, SQL Server) and willingness to work with various modern frameworks and tooling •Firm grasp of multi-threading and efficient cross-process communication •Working knowledge of interacting with the Windows API and COM objects •Advocacy for OOP design principles and engineering best practices with a focus on code quality, CI/CD and scalability •Strong debugging skills – methodically decomposing systems to identify bottlenecks, diagnosing issues, troubleshooting and implementing maintainable solutions •Drive to continually develop your skills, improve team processes and reduce debt •Fluency in English and ability to effectively communicate abstract ideas, complex concepts and technical trade-offs

Benefits

Benefits We take a structured approach to determining compensation, leveraging our internal framework, market insights, and candidate skills and experience level. In addition to competitive salaries, we offer retirement and healthcare benefits and ample paid time off, as well as valuable non-monetary perks such as flexible schedules and location, end-to-end ownership and the opportunity to contribute to projects that are poised to shape the future of work.

Apply Now
Built by Lior Neu-ner. I'd love to hear your feedback — Get in touch via DM or lior@remoterocketship.com